New South Wales
THE MOST POPULAR STATE IN AUSTRALIA?
New South Wales is where most travellers begin their Australia trip since it's where Sydney is located. This is Australia's oldest state and there is a lot to see and do.
Once you’ve had enough of the Opera House and Bondi Beach, head north-west to the popular Blue Mountains which make for a fantastic destination for first-time campers who don’t want to go too far.
The New South Wales coastline has plenty of small towns which are perfect for spending a few days. Byron Bay might just be the most popular but there’s no need to follow the crowds if you don’t want to. You’ll get a wide variety of deserted beaches and incredible landscapes.
